I am fast bowler and middle order batsmen, i have been having heel pain ( basically my doctor said i have Plantar fasciitis ). Are there any good recommended shoe which i can use it for bowling and batting which has high Arch support ? Any suggestions would really help.

there are different types of custom insoles, there are the ones from a physio, orthotics but they are very expensive.

you can get some made up for you in some running shops, there is a JD sports just off cheapside near st pauls which have a machine too.

but actually many of the off the shelf products are really good, ortholite or footdisc are 2.
